Transaction 51ac26548d7585fb4e15d2c8f47ed338b2cea54be81b95be67b725f58c2211de
1 Input
1 Output
-
51ac26548d7585fb4e15d2c8f47ed338b2cea54be81b95be67b725f58c2211de:0
- value
- 509696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dbb5aec67029535920c8ce6a037c7d505b8b094 OP_EQUAL
- address
- 3G52TKtiqKpRoUmboyD2Dv7kM9N1pnUnZQ